how to view the results of an antenna-type analysis in vision. This type of analysis
is in fact, a mixed electric/electromagnetic under the assumption of radiation in the
far-field. The user is able to consult both the results of the electrical stimulation, such
as the incident and reflected powers at each port of the antenna and the radiation pattern
of the latter. The proposed graphs take into account the variations established in the VAR
block as well as the variations in the azimuth angle (Phi) and elevation (Theta) obtained
from the EM simulation files.
From example described in Setup Antenna schematic, we will
analyze the performances of an ANTENNA model associated with HPA-B-HF model. The
basic steps to visualize are:
Open the schematic example from Setup Antenna schematic.
Click on Simulate>Run simulation or on the shortcut . The output console is displayed:
Figure: Console
The console window contains the simulation time, the simulation mode, the
repertory of the results, and also any warnings and errors encountered during
the simulation.
When closing the console window, simulation results appear in the application
tree in the folder named after the simulation "sim0". In "sim0", click on
Output graphs tab to access the measurements provided by the probes.
Select Waveform Probes to display magnitude and phase of incident and
reflected powers at each antenna ports and data from others probes from
the schematic. By displaying the magnitude of incident power, you can see the
variation according to the vertical phase shift variable phase_shiftY.
You can find a specific antenna port by looking on the index in the graph title.
For example, to identify port number 7, look at the index P7 in graph
title as mag(antenna_4_4_pIncP7).
Figure: Output Graphs
Click on Filter button to select one or several curves depending on the
horizontal phase shift variable phase_shiftX.
Figure: Filter feature on graph
Click on Antenna tab named as the Antenna block from the
schematic. In this example, the tab is named antenna_4x4. You have access
to several graphs which plot radiation patterns.
Figure: Antenna radiation pattern
Click on Far field pattern 3D tab to display radiation pattern on 3D
graph. Click and drag on the 3D graph to change the orientation of the axes. On
the top-right, select the data to plot. By default, Etotal is selected.
Click on Filter button to select data from specific values of variables
phase_shiftX and phase_shiftY. If Theta is selected on
Sweep type, select all Phi angles to plot a complete 3D
radiation pattern depending on angle resolution and limit available in Far
Field data.
Figure: 3D radiation pattern graph
Click on Far field pattern tab to display radiation pattern data
according to Theta and Phi angles.
Figure: Far Field pattern
Click on Far field pattern 2D tab to display radiation pattern cuts
according to Theta or Phi angles.
Figure: Far field pattern 2D
Click on Far field pattern Polar 2D tab to display radiation pattern
cuts on polar plot.
